## Further Reading

Splitpane is our diff viewer for files too large to load into memory; it streams hunks from the Corvelle chunk store and renders them lazily. Security reviewers should pay particular attention to how the chunk fetcher validates byte ranges and how temporary render caches are scoped per session, since both have been sources of past findings. The threat model, prior review notes, and the sandboxing design are consolidated on the internal page below.

operations page: https://jira.qorvelsys.internal/browse/pages/browse/pages

Ticket OPT-961: Pickpath optimizer misbehaving in the Brindlemoor staging warehouse sim. Review of last week's change shows the env file was regenerated from the wrong template, dropping two variables. The optimizer now skips the routing-service call and emits naive pick lists, which masked a real regression in aisle clustering. For the reviewer: please confirm the template fix in the attached branch restores both variables. The first is ROUTING_HOST, already corrected; the second is the routing credential, set by the following line.

vault entry, yahif-yajep: COURIER_KEY29=b802bdf8034096b65a51c6ba5abe2

**Ticket: Tracing config drift on Wrenfield services**

Spans from the checkout and inventory services stopped joining into single traces after the Pellgrove rollout; sampling rates and propagation headers no longer match across the fleet. Future maintainers: always change tracing settings via the shared overlay, never per-service. The canonical tracing configuration, which every service must carry, is as follows.

service settings:
PRAWYN_PIN=9848
PRAWYN_METRICS_HOST=metrics.prawyn.lumicworks.corp
PRAWYN_LOG_LEVEL=warn
PRAWYN_TENANT=pelius

Capacity note: report builder sort stability (Orchardline)

The report builder now uses a stable merge sort for multi-column grouping, which raised peak memory per worker by roughly 15% on wide datasets. This is acceptable at current volumes but limits headroom during quarter-end runs. Release should not raise worker concurrency without also adjusting the buffer constants. The figures we validated in staging are as follows.

tuning table, yajog-yahof:
BUDGETS = {
    "lamvan": 303,
    "wenox": 460,
    "fenvan": 525,
}